Some comments:
1. You don't have a "credit score". Your credit rating will be affected by the debt created, but the impact will depend on lots of things.
2. When using the calculator above, it will not take into account the fact that you may be able to put your own money into the FlexDirect account...so the profit will be overstated.
3. You have less than 12 months remaining on your introductory rate with Nationwide.
And finally, I'm not sure why Nationwide are paying you "5% per month"...everyone else gets 5% per year!0
